'Whose Line Is It Anyway?' features real improv. The comedians perform unscripted scenes, games, and sketches based on prompts given by the host and suggestions from the audience. While some structure is provided to create a cohesive show, the performers' reactions and dialogue are genuinely spontaneous.

- What is improv comedy? Improv comedy is a form of live theater where scenes, dialogues, and games are performed spontaneously without a script, relying on creativity and audience suggestions.
- Is 'Whose Line Is It Anyway?' scripted or improvised? 'Whose Line Is It Anyway?' is genuinely improvised. Performers create scenes and games spontaneously based on prompts, with no pre-written scripts.
- How do comedians on 'Whose Line Is It Anyway?' create their scenes? Comedians use host prompts and audience suggestions to spontaneously generate scenes, dialogue, and games, relying on sharp wit and quick thinking.
